The true pelvis is ______ to the false pelvis.
A
superior
B
posterior
C
anterior
D
inferior
Verified step by step guidance
1
Step 1: Understand the anatomical terms used in the question. The 'true pelvis' refers to the region of the pelvis below the pelvic brim, which contains the pelvic cavity. The 'false pelvis' refers to the area above the pelvic brim, which is part of the abdominal cavity.
Step 2: Recall the spatial relationship between the true pelvis and the false pelvis. The true pelvis is located lower in the body compared to the false pelvis, making it 'inferior' in position.
Step 3: Review the options provided in the question: superior, posterior, anterior, and inferior. Determine which term accurately describes the position of the true pelvis relative to the false pelvis.
Step 4: Eliminate incorrect options based on anatomical orientation. 'Superior' would mean above, which is incorrect. 'Posterior' would mean behind, which does not apply here. 'Anterior' would mean in front, which is also incorrect. 'Inferior' means below, which matches the anatomical relationship.
Step 5: Confirm the correct answer by visualizing or referencing a diagram of the pelvis. The true pelvis is indeed located inferior to the false pelvis.
